A Quiet Suburb with Close-Knit Roots
Parma Heights is a small city of about 19,000 residents situated just west of Parma. The community has a distinct identity despite its proximity to its larger neighbor. York Road and Pearl Road serve as the main commercial corridors, where local businesses and longtime residents share the same streets.
